7) After recording log, attach the created file to your GitHub issue post.Log type | Description |
---|---|
log-ball | Full buffer logcat. Don't use unless requested |
log-all | Verbose logcat, messy but records everything |
log-e | Log for Error filter, only shows crashes |
log-ril | Log for Modem/SIM and other RIL issues |
log-kmsg | Log for Kernel msg when the kernel panics |
log-dmsg | Log for Kernel on an active system |
log-ActiveDmesg | Looping Log for Kernel on active system |
log-dump | Get the prev_dump.log (Don't use unless requested by Dev) |
